XAML:
<RadioButton Margin="15" Grid.Row="0" Grid.Column="3" Style=" {StaticResource SpeedButtonStyle}" Content="TEST"/>
Style:
<!-- Speed Button Style -->
<Style x:Key="SpeedButtonStyle" TargetType="{x:Type ToggleButton}" BasedOn="{StaticResource {x:Type ToggleButton}}">
<Setter Property="FontSize" Value="18px"/>
<Setter Property="FontWeight" Value="Normal"/>
<Setter Property="Background" Value="{StaticResource SidePanelButtonBgInactive}"/>
<Setter Property="Foreground" Value="White"/>
<Style.Triggers>
<Trigger Property="IsMouseOver" Value="True">
<Setter Property="Background" Value="{StaticResource SidePanelButtonBgActive}"/>
<Setter Property="Foreground" Value="{StaticResource SidePanelButtonFgActive}"/>
</Trigger>
<Trigger Property="IsChecked" Value="True">
<Setter Property="BorderThickness" Value="30"/>
<Setter Property="BorderBrush" Value="White" />
<Setter Property="Background" Value="{StaticResource SidePanelButtonBgActive}"/>
<Setter Property="Foreground" Value="{StaticResource SidePanelButtonFgActive}"/>
</Trigger>
</Style.Triggers>
</Style>
I am trying to change the size of the border on my radio button which is styled like a toggle button. I can change the colour of the border but not the size. it seems to be using the default size which is realy thin.